SYNOPSIS
Makes $15 million in federal funds available to EDA to support businesses and nonprofits in need.
CURRENT VERSION OF TEXT
As reported by the Assembly Commerce and Economic Development Committee on March 8, 2021, with amendments.
1[A Supplement to the Fiscal Year 2021 appropriations act, P.L.2020, c.97] An Act making federal funding available to the New Jersey Economic Development Authority to support businesses and nonprofits in need1.
Be It Enacted by the Senate and the General Assembly of the State of New Jersey:

The amount hereinabove appropriated for Coronavirus Relief Fund - Assistance to Businesses and Nonprofits, EDA shall be allocated from a portion of federal block grant funds allocated to the State from the federal "Coronavirus Relief Fund" established pursuant to the federal "Coronavirus Aid, Relief, and Economic Security Act (CARES Act)," Pub.L.116-136, or any other federal funds made available to the State in response to the co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ic.
The amount hereinabove appropriated for Coronavirus Relief Fund - Assistance to Businesses and Nonprofits, EDA shall be allocated by the New Jersey Economic Development Authority to businesses and nonprofit organizations in this State to prevent additional business and nonprofit organization closures, to preserve and create jobs, and to spur economic recovery. The New Jersey Economic Development Authority shall establish minimum grant eligibility criteria and the size of the grant awards to meet the needs of the grantee entities in responding to the public health crisis.]1
11. a.
Subject to the availability of federal funds provided
or made accessible to the State via federal block grant funds allocated
to the State from the federal "Coronavirus Relief Fund" established pursuant to the federal "Coronavirus Aid, Relief, and Economic Security Act (CARES Act)," Pub.L.116-136, or any other federal funds made available to the State in response to the co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ic, $15,000,000 from such federal funds shall be made available to the New Jersey Economic Development Authority for the purposes set forth in subsection b. of this section.
b. The funds made available to the New Jersey Economic Development Authority pursuant to subsection a. of this section shall be reserved by the authority to provide financial support, by way of grants, to businesses and nonprofits.
c. The New Jersey Economic Development Authority shall establish the size of the awards and eligibility of entities in subsection b. of this section to meet the needs of businesses and nonprofits in responding to the public health crisis.1
2. This act shall take effect immediately.
